Summary
House Resolution 11 (HR11) is a commendatory resolution honoring Coach Tom Knox upon his retirement from Youree Drive Middle AP Magnet School in Shreveport after thirty-three years of dedicated service. The resolution recognizes Coach Knox's significant contributions not only as a head football coach but also as a physical education teacher. Under his leadership, the school’s football team achieved commendable success, including city championships during multiple seasons, highlighting his impact on student athletes both on and off the field.
